Requires military leaders to report on promotion chances for enlisted service members in key jobs.
This bill would require military leaders to give Congress a detailed report on promotion opportunities for enlisted service members in specific jobs like cyber and air traffic control. The report would cover the last three promotion cycles, showing how many members are eligible, how many get promoted, and how long it takes. This aims to give Congress a clearer picture of career paths for these service members.
Today, military department leaders are not specifically required by law to provide Congress with detailed briefings on promotion opportunities for enlisted members in specific jobs. If this bill becomes law, the Secretary of each military department would be required to submit a comprehensive briefing to Congress within 180 days. This briefing would detail promotion data and challenges for enlisted members in six key military occupational specialties over the past three promotion cycles.
